Academic Integrity

Canadian University Dubai's Learning Resource Centre guide includes guidance that generative AI tools should be cited when AI-created content is paraphrased, quoted, or incorporated into a user's work, and that functional uses such as editing or translation should be acknowledged.

Preuve 1
The Modern Language Association (MLA) recommendations for citing generative AI are the following; cite a generative AI tool whenever you paraphrase, quote, or incorporate into your own work any content (whether text, image, data, or other) that was created by it; acknowledge all functional uses of the tool (like editing your prose or translating words) in a note, your text, or another suitable location; take care to vet the secondary sources it cites.
